About the role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a motivated, reliable and flexible individual to join our site services team and play a key role in the school's continued improvement journey. The Local Governing Body is seeking to appoint a Site Services Officer to help maintain a safe, secure and well-presented environment for our students, staff and visitors at Lyng Hall School.
We are looking for a professional and enthusiastic individual with practical maintenance skills and a proactive approach to site management. The successful candidate will have excellent problem-solving and communication skills, be able to prioritise workloads effectively, work independently using their own initiative, and demonstrate a strong attention to detail. A commitment to maintaining high standards of health, safety, and security across the school site is essential.

Online Checks
In line with KCSIE (Keeping children Safe in Education) 2025 we will complete online searches as part of our due diligence on all shortlisted candidates. If anything is identified as part of these checks they will be discussed with you at interview. If any safeguarding concerns are identified we reserve the right to withdraw your application.
